I thought Ken Rosenthal said it would've been well north of 300 million over time with incentives and bonuses, etc? 

They had an offer on the table that was, per the most recent reports, $250 million guaranteed over 8 years, with years 9 and 10 as  $35 million a year vesting options with 550 plate appearances, and no opt out. Unless Machado was still an all star at age 34, he would never see that money, as any smart franchise would platoon him to keep his plate appearances low. Furthermore, the White Sox did not offer an opt out, while the Padres did, so if Machado remains an all star through age 31, the Padres offer will also turn into far more than $300 million over time because he'll hit free agency again at age 31, after the next CBA, with a chance to cash in >$150 million at the time. 

Here's the guarantees: $300/10, with an opt out after 5,

$250/8, with 2 vesting options you're unlikely to receive.

Those offers aren't close.
